javascript編輯軟件 javascript的編寫工具
很多朋友對于javascript編輯軟件和javascript的編寫工具不太懂,今天就由小編來為大家分享,希望可以幫助到大家,下面一起來看看吧!大屏制作軟件就工具而言,...
很多朋友對于javascript編輯軟件和javascript的編寫工具不太懂,今天就由小編來為大家分享,希望可以幫助到大家,下面一起來看看吧!
大屏制作軟件
就工具而言,數(shù)據(jù)大屏可以用Excel、JS開發(fā)、報(bào)表工具、BI工具等來實(shí)現(xiàn)。但對于實(shí)時(shí)更新、數(shù)據(jù)量支撐、后臺響應(yīng),平臺運(yùn)維等需求,性能卻各有差異。
js游戲引擎排名
1.melonJS
melonJS是一個(gè)輕量級的基于2dsprite的引擎,供開發(fā)人員和設(shè)計(jì)人員用于游戲開發(fā)。melonJS的一個(gè)突出特點(diǎn)是它是完全獨(dú)立的,不需要外部插件即可工作。但是,有第三方工具被證明可以改善您使用引擎的體驗(yàn)。
2.巴比倫.js
Babylon.js是下一代Web渲染3D技術(shù)。它負(fù)責(zé)創(chuàng)建行業(yè)領(lǐng)先的游戲,例如SpaceInvaders和TempleRun2。
3.移相器
Phaser是一個(gè)開源2D引擎,具有創(chuàng)建WebGL和畫布驅(qū)動(dòng)游戲的重要功能。該引擎專為希望將游戲創(chuàng)意變?yōu)楝F(xiàn)實(shí)的游戲開發(fā)者而設(shè)計(jì)。
4.PixiJS
PixiJS是一個(gè)渲染引擎,可讓您創(chuàng)建交互式圖形、多平臺應(yīng)用程序和游戲,而無需擔(dān)心WebGLAPI或設(shè)備兼容性。因此,它能夠?qū)⑺俣群唾|(zhì)量融入2D游戲的圖形和質(zhì)量——類似于WebGL對3D圖形的工作方式——使其成為游戲開發(fā)的可靠選擇。
5.獼猴桃
Kiwi的加速WebGL閱讀能力使其成為開發(fā)優(yōu)質(zhì)游戲的理想選擇。它與Cocoon.js的關(guān)聯(lián)確保您可以輕松地跨桌面和移動(dòng)瀏覽器部署游戲。它是一個(gè)開源的HTML5引擎,支持WebGL渲染、多點(diǎn)觸控和2D畫布。
6.PlayCanvas
PlayCanvas是一個(gè)游戲引擎,其基礎(chǔ)架構(gòu)支持2D和3D游戲圖形。
7.GDevelop
GDevelop是一個(gè)獨(dú)特的基于事件系統(tǒng)的開源引擎。您可以跨多個(gè)平臺輕松編譯和導(dǎo)出通過該引擎創(chuàng)建的游戲。
8.Impact.js
Impact.js是一個(gè)將游戲開發(fā)提升到另一個(gè)層次的引擎。它提供先進(jìn)的行業(yè)工具和標(biāo)準(zhǔn)軟件更新,引導(dǎo)您創(chuàng)建自己的游戲。
app.js是什么文件可刪嗎
app.js是一個(gè)常見的文件名,通常用于存放網(wǎng)頁應(yīng)用程序的JavaScript代碼。這個(gè)文件通常包含了網(wǎng)頁應(yīng)用程序的邏輯和功能實(shí)現(xiàn)。
是否可以刪除app.js文件取決于你的具體情況。如果你確定這個(gè)文件不再需要,或者你想要?jiǎng)h除整個(gè)網(wǎng)頁應(yīng)用程序,那么你可以刪除它。但是,請確保在刪除之前備份重要的文件,以防止數(shù)據(jù)丟失。
然而,如果你只是想清理或優(yōu)化你的文件結(jié)構(gòu),建議先備份app.js文件,然后再進(jìn)行刪除。這樣,如果你發(fā)現(xiàn)刪除后出現(xiàn)了問題,你可以恢復(fù)原始的app.js文件。
同時(shí)支持c c++ java javascript的IDE有什么推薦
這里推薦一個(gè)軟件—VSCode,插件擴(kuò)展豐富,安裝相應(yīng)插件后,同時(shí)支持C/C++,Java,Javascript的編輯和運(yùn)行,下面我簡單介紹一下各個(gè)環(huán)境的配置過程:
1.C/C++:這里需要先安裝C/C++forVisualStudioCode這個(gè)插件,之后再安裝MinGW編譯器,就可以編輯運(yùn)行C/C++代碼了,主要配置過程如下:
安裝C/C++forVisualStudioCode插件,這個(gè)直接在Extensions擴(kuò)展中搜索就行,直接點(diǎn)擊右下角install安裝就行:
安裝成功后,我們就需要下載MinGW編譯器,這個(gè)直接到官網(wǎng)下載適合自己平臺的版本就行:
一切就緒后,我們編寫一個(gè)簡單的測試文件—test.cpp,隨便寫入幾行代碼:
之后,點(diǎn)擊Debug運(yùn)行,選擇“C++(GDB/LLDB)”,對省城launch.json文件進(jìn)行簡單配置,主要指明調(diào)試的文件,及編譯器gdb的路徑,如下:
接著再創(chuàng)建一個(gè)tasks.json文件,配置如下:
最后就可以點(diǎn)擊Debug調(diào)試運(yùn)行C/C++代碼了,如下:
2.Java:這里需要先安裝JavaExtensionPack和JavaDebug,之后再配置一下java.home路徑,就可以編輯運(yùn)行Java代碼了,下面我簡單介紹一下配置過程:
安裝JavaExtensionPack和JavaDebug,這個(gè)直接搜索安裝就行,如下:
安裝完成后,這里簡單編寫一個(gè)Test類,主要代碼如下:
接著點(diǎn)擊Debug運(yùn)行,對生成的launch.json文件進(jìn)行配置,主要指明類名:
接著點(diǎn)擊右下角的設(shè)置,進(jìn)入Settings,搜索java.home,配置一下jdk路徑,如下:
最后,點(diǎn)擊Debug運(yùn)行,就可以調(diào)試運(yùn)行java代碼了:
3.Javascript:這個(gè)比較簡單,只需要安裝一下node環(huán)境,就可以調(diào)試運(yùn)行Javascript代碼了,主要配置如下:
安裝nodejs,這個(gè)直接到官網(wǎng)下載就行,選擇一個(gè)適合自己平臺的版本即可:
安裝成功后,這里編寫一些Js測試代碼,如下:
點(diǎn)擊Debug,調(diào)整launch.json文件如下,指明node及調(diào)試運(yùn)行的js文件:
最后點(diǎn)擊Debug,就可以調(diào)試運(yùn)行Javascript代碼了,如下:
至此,我們就完成了在VSCode中配置C/C++,Java,Javascript這3個(gè)編程環(huán)境。總的來說,整個(gè)過程都挺簡單的,只要你熟悉一下配置過程,很快就能掌握的,我以前的回答中,也有詳細(xì)介紹,當(dāng)然,你也可以使用Eclipse,安裝對應(yīng)插件,也能完成相應(yīng)功能,網(wǎng)上也有相關(guān)資料和教程可供參考,感興趣的可以搜一下,希望以上分享的內(nèi)容能對你有所幫助吧,也歡迎大家評論、留言。
js文件需要自己編寫嗎
回答如下:是的,JavaScript文件需要自己編寫。JavaScript是一種腳本語言,用于在網(wǎng)頁上添加交互性和動(dòng)態(tài)功能。開發(fā)人員需要編寫JavaScript代碼來實(shí)現(xiàn)所需的功能,例如處理用戶輸入、操作網(wǎng)頁元素、發(fā)送請求和處理響應(yīng)等。
html5有什么好用的編輯軟件嗎
我猜你一定對可以進(jìn)行網(wǎng)頁開發(fā)和web應(yīng)用制作的html5的編輯器會(huì)比較感興趣吧。那么我就推薦幾款html5編輯器來供參考。
第一款,Dreamweaver,
Adobe出品的Dreamweaver是一款集網(wǎng)頁制作和管理網(wǎng)站與一身的,所見即所得的網(wǎng)頁編輯器,Dreamweaver是一款針對專業(yè)網(wǎng)頁設(shè)計(jì)師,而特別開發(fā)的視覺化工具,利用Dreamweaver可以很容易的制作出,跨平臺限制,跨瀏覽器限制的網(wǎng)頁。而新版本的Dreamweavercs5.5突出的特點(diǎn)就是直接提供了對html5的支持,通過css面板設(shè)置樣式,在您調(diào)整屏幕尺寸的同時(shí),也可以應(yīng)用不同的樣式,使用html5進(jìn)行編碼的同時(shí),提供代碼提示和設(shè)計(jì)視圖的渲染支持。
第二款,Webstorm,
Webstorm,在國內(nèi)被開發(fā)者譽(yù)為web前端開發(fā)神器,Webstorm因強(qiáng)大的智能提示功能而聞名,Webstorm的代碼補(bǔ)全功能,幾乎包含了所有流行的庫,像什么jquery、yui、dojo、prototype、mootools和bindows等等。Webstorm還有代碼檢測,代碼智能重構(gòu)、快速修改功能、內(nèi)置debug功能,可以斷點(diǎn)調(diào)試,可以直接運(yùn)行js代碼,內(nèi)置了版本比較功能,每隔一段時(shí)間會(huì)自動(dòng)保存,并且可以快速進(jìn)行版本比較,自帶服務(wù)器功能,可直接模擬服務(wù)器環(huán)境,可直接運(yùn)行npm命令等等,在使用的過程中可以讓工作輕松不少。Webstorm兼容windows、macos以及l(fā)inux平臺。
第三款,Rendera,
Rendera能夠在設(shè)計(jì)或者瀏覽源代碼的時(shí)候,進(jìn)行同步的編輯。Rendera最大的特點(diǎn)就是支持sass和html,你可以在瀏覽器的過程中輕松的運(yùn)用html5和css3,因此就會(huì)加速html5和css3的學(xué)習(xí)進(jìn)程。你還可以借助Rendera來測試你的javascript編碼,或者是jquery工具等等。
第四款,Maqetta,
由于Maqetta本身就是應(yīng)用htnl5/ajax編寫的,因此在瀏覽器中運(yùn)行就不需要下載額外的插件。Maqetta的功能包括開發(fā)和設(shè)計(jì)工作,網(wǎng)頁可視編輯,主題編輯,wysiwyg可視化頁面編輯器,拖拽式移動(dòng)ui的設(shè)計(jì),窗口小部件,javascript庫等等。Maqetta幾乎支持所有的瀏覽器,例如chrome和safari。
第五款,BlueGriffon,
BlueGriffon提供了全新的wysiwyg,即是所見即所得的內(nèi)容編輯器。BlueGriffon是可以免費(fèi)下載的,BlueGriffon同時(shí)支持windows、linux和macos三個(gè)平臺,BlueGriffon可以幫助你制作和編輯所有的html5以及htnl5的文件。用戶可以很容易的制作網(wǎng)頁和精細(xì)的ui界面。BlueGriffon是支持中文的。
第六款,AptanaStudio,
AptanaStudio是一個(gè)集成式的web應(yīng)用程序開發(fā)環(huán)境,AptanaStudio不僅可以作為獨(dú)立的程序運(yùn)行,也可以作為eclipse插件來使用。所以,如果已經(jīng)安裝了eclipse的話,就可以將AptanaStudio作為插件安裝到eclipse環(huán)境中。AptanaStudio最廣為人知的是它非常強(qiáng)悍的javascript編輯器和調(diào)試器。AptanaStudio可以支持多種ajax和javascript工具箱。此外AptanaStudio還吸收了radrails項(xiàng)目,添加了非常強(qiáng)大的rubyonrails的支持。
總結(jié),由于互聯(lián)網(wǎng)已經(jīng)發(fā)生了天翻地覆的變化,使得html5不得不先人一步做出改變。Html編輯器實(shí)質(zhì)上是用來制作網(wǎng)頁的應(yīng)用程序,專業(yè)的html編輯器和其額外的功能可以為開發(fā)者提供很大的便利。
文章分享結(jié)束,javascript編輯軟件和javascript的編寫工具的答案你都知道了嗎?歡迎再次光臨本站哦!
本文鏈接:http://xinin56.com/kaifa/2080.html